About The Position

The VP & Commercial Real Estate Appraisal Review Officer facilitates the request and review of commercial real estate valuations to determine market value for related financial transactions in accordance with internal bank policies/procedures, industry standards and regulatory requirements. (USPAP & FIRREA). This position may be a voting member of the Executive Loan Committee that has lending authority up to the bank’s legal lending limit.
